So, what exactly is a custom clutch assembly?
In simple terms, a custom clutch assembly is a tailored component designed to transmit torque between mechanical systems, but with modifications to fit specific needs like size, material, or operating environment. Think of it as a “made-to-order” solution instead of off-the-shelf parts. For instance, industrial pneumatic clutch assemblies use compressed air for engagement, making them ideal for applications requiring rapid response and overload protection . They’re not your everyday car clutches; these are built for heavy-duty stuff like conveyor systems or automated production lines.
Now, why would you even consider a custom option? Well, standard clutches might not cut it if you’re dealing with unique shaft sizes, high-frequency cycling, or corrosive environments. Custom assemblies let you tweak everything from torque capacity to cooling options, which is a game-changer for minimizing downtime.

How does an industrial pneumatic clutch assembly actually work?
I bet you’re wondering, “Okay, but what’s going on inside that thing?” Great question! Basically, when compressed air is supplied, it pushes a piston or diaphragm to engage friction elements—this connects the driving and driven parts to transmit torque. When the air is released, boom, disengagement happens almost instantly. This mechanism reduces mechanical shock and allows remote control, which is why it’s a favorite in modern automation .
But wait, there’s a catch: you need a steady air supply. If your setup has pressure fluctuations, it could lead to inconsistent engagement. So, always check your operating pressure specs before committing.
When should you choose an industrial pneumatic clutch assembly?
Not every situation calls for a pneumatic solution. Based on my experience, here’s when it makes sense:
Frequent Start-Stop Cycles: If your machinery starts and stops repeatedly, pneumatics reduce wear compared to mechanical clutches.
Overload Protection Needed: They disengage smoothly under overload, preventing damage to other components.
Remote Operations: Ideal for systems where manual intervention isn’t feasible.
On the flip side, for low-budget projects or environments with dust/lack of air compressors, you might opt for something simpler like a mechanical clutch. It’s all about matching the clutch to your actual needs.
A step-by-step guide to selecting the right custom clutch
Identify Your Torque Requirements: Calculate the max torque your system needs. Pneumatic clutches can be customized here, but undersizing leads to failure .
Check Shaft and Mounting specs: Measure bore sizes and space constraints. Custom options allow adjustments, but provide accurate dimensions to avoid fit issues.
Consider the Operating Environment: For humid or corrosive settings, request features like protective coatings or forced cooling.
Review Response Time Needs: If you need millisecond-level engagement, pneumatics are winner; for slower systems, hydraulic might suffice.

Common pitfalls to avoid – learn from my mistakes!
Ignoring Maintenance: Pneumatic clutches require air filter checks; skipping this leads to debris buildup and failure.
Overlooking Compatibility: Even a custom clutch can fail if paired with mismatched components—always consult technical specs.
Choosing Price Over Quality: Cheap clones might save upfront, but they cost more in repairs. Stick to certified suppliers with ISO standards .
